DWP issues early payment warning for pensioners due to bank holiday

The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) has issued a warning to pensioners and benefit recipients that payments may arrive early this week due to the upcoming August bank holiday on Monday, August 31.

Because the bank holiday prevents payments from being processed on Monday, those due to receive funds on that day will instead receive them on Friday, August 28. This adjustment affects various benefits, including State Pensions, Universal Credit, Personal Independence Payment (PIP), Attendance Allowance, and Carer’s Allowance.

Minister for Social Security and Disability Sir Stephen Timms stated that the early payments are intended to ensure families and older people receive their money without disruption during the holiday period.
